The first two patches reorganize the Kconfig for the iwlegacy drivers. This is
intended to make the debug options appear in a more logical manner.

The second two patches remove some unused code from the iwlegacy driver.

These patches are based on the wireless-next tree.

+menu "Debugging Options"
+	depends on IWLEGACY
+
+config IWLEGACY_DEBUG
+	bool "Enable full debugging output in iwlegacy (iwl 3945/4965) drivers"
+	depends on IWLEGACY
+	---help---
+	  This option will enable debug tracing output for the iwlegacy
+	  drivers.
+
+	  This will result in the kernel module being ~100k larger.  You can
+	  control which debug output is sent to the kernel log by setting the
+	  value in
+
+		/sys/class/net/wlan0/device/debug_level
+
+	  This entry will only exist if this option is enabled.
+
+	  To set a value, simply echo an 8-byte hex value to the same file:
+
+		  % echo 0x43fff > /sys/class/net/wlan0/device/debug_level
+
+	  You can find the list of debug mask values in:
+		  drivers/net/wireless/iwlegacy/common.h
+
+	  If this is your first time using this driver, you should say Y here
+	  as the debug information can assist others in helping you resolve
+	  any problems you may encounter.
+
+config IWLEGACY_DEBUGFS
+        bool "iwlegacy (iwl 3945/4965) debugfs support"
+        depends on IWLEGACY && MAC80211_DEBUGFS
+        ---help---
+	  Enable creation of debugfs files for the iwlegacy drivers. This
+	  is a low-impact option that allows getting insight into the
+	  driver's state at runtime.
+
+endmenu

Remove the enum il_calib. It defined one identifier: IL_CALIB_MAX.
Remove the function il4965_calib_free_results. It was doing nothing
because IL_CALIB_MAX is zero. Next, remove calib_results from the
il_priv structure and also remove the associated return
type/struct il_calib_result.
